@danillo; no because it introduces far too many bugs in multiple areas of the interface. A lot of the interface has been both designed and built around the concept of a launcher on the left hand side, and supporting multiple launcher locations in a official release would incur a significant extra ongoing cost (both design and development wise), and we are currently focusing our limited resources on stabilisation and some brand new features ;-)
